This document contains an exercise for an electric technology student. It asks the student to list 5 common electrician tools, explain the difference between a splice and a joint with examples of each, and to draw and write 5 electrical symbols. The tools listed are linesman pliers, needle-nose pliers, fish tape, voltmeter/multimeter, and wire crimpers. Splices unite two rope ends or the end and body, while joints fit pieces together at a joint or joints. Examples of joints given are plain tap/tee joints and rat tail joints. Examples of splices are western union short tie splice and britannia splice.
